Rising Aotearoa / New Zealand-based singer-songwriter, Jude Kelly has unveiled her debut EP, The Seven Spirits Of Her. To celebrate, the singer has curated an exclusive playlist for MILKY full of tracks she was listening to when recording the collection of songs.
"The Seven Spirits of Her has become almost an audio biopic," Kelly says of the EP. "Each song harnesses a different story that taps into an experience or a part of us - whether it's love, contentment, being confused with life, or growing up too quickly, one cannot be without the other. In a sweet way, it’s questions I asked when I was 15, answered. These stories have been for me, but I hope when people listen to the EP they too can see the beauty in the ugly."
Writing and recording can be heavily influenced by what you listen to…or it cannot, everything is subjective…mostly. In my case, while I write and record, I don't listen to much music or if I do, it's very different to what I make. My list below is what I listened to throughout the creation of the record. For the purpose of themes, this is also a ‘which song belongs where’ and next to the songs I listened to, will be a song off my record I think matches the energy.
ST VINCENT - FLEA
Jude’s pick: Siren Song
“I'm just like a hungry little flea” St Vincent's voice comes in, it curls my toes and then the bass line goes and I’m moving my shoulders in a march-like manner. So inspired by St Vincent. Feels like doing the dance at the end of Saltburn through the house naked.
NICK CAVE & THE BAD SEEDS - GALLEON SHIP
During a 2-week recording trip in Hawkes Bay Feb 2024, my accommodation was a 40 minute trip from the studio. I’d queue up an album to listen through on the drive. Ghosteen was the album I chose on a particularly heavy day - I think I just weeped to this for 40 minutes. It’s so beautiful and it was a great ‘I love music’ moment.
TYLER, THE CREATOR - LUMBERJACK
Jude’s pick: Monster Truck
Another record that was listened to on that 40 min drive home. I tend to stray away from listening to any music remotely similar to mine when writing and recording.
FLORENCE + THE MACHINE - FREE
Jude’s pick: Clarence
In hindsight, I think this song inspired me a lot with the record. The rush, the lure, the freedom, the dance. I saw Florence live in 2023 just before locking in on my EP, I think this influence can be heard in my song Clarence.
OKAY KAYA - THE WANNABE
Jude’s pick: Married to Her Death
Like a massage for your ears - great for the end of the day after 8 hours of recording.
SUPERVIOLET - BIG SONGBIRDS DON’T CRY
Jude’s pick: Lucky
Super cool artist I found during that period of keeping the music I listen to far from what I am making.
MGMT - BUBBLEGUM DOG
This was an album that came out mid my recording and I think this was just so great - one of my top albums of the year, and while I made the record.
BRIGHT EYES - BELLS AND WHISTLES
New album from a favourite band deserved its repeats - this one is particularly bedazzled.
THE DARE - GIRLS
Jude’s pick: Bonnet Bunny
Like awesome - I’d call this the ’switch off’ track.
THE BREEDERS - DO YOU LOVE ME NOW?
Jude’s pick: Like You
At the end of making an EP or Album, once everything is mostly recorded, you are working on the mixes, and the date of release is set - it feels transitional… well it certainly did for me and this song was one of the songs I clung to and still haven’t let go.
